Yves Rocher Foundation Photography Award

About the award

The Yves Rocher Foundation Photography Award was created in 2015 by the Yves Rocher Foundation in partnership with Visa pour l’Image – Perpignan.

The award is granted to allow a professional photographer to conduct a report on issues related to the environment, the relationship between human beings and the earth, or the challenges of the transition to a green economy.

It is sponsored by the Yves Rocher Foundation.

    Visa pour l'Image: Current events around the world

    Every year since 1989, the international festival of photojournalism, Visa pour l'Image Perpignan, has reviewed the events of the previous year, covering social issues, conflicts and the state of the world viewed via a variety of subjects and from different points of view.

    The program includes: exhibitions, evening screenings, round tables, workshops, portfolio reviews, school weeks, the chance to meet photographers, awards and grants.
